数字金额转大写函数
import java.text.DecimalFormat; public class ChangeMoney{ //我写的. public static String moneyToRMB(double d){ String[] digit = { "无", "分", "角", "元", "拾", "佰", "仟", "万", "拾", "佰", "仟", "亿", "拾", "佰", "仟"}; String[] capi = { "零", "壹", "贰", "叁", "肆", "伍", "陆", "柒", "捌", "玖"}; DecimalFormat df = new DecimalFormat("###0.00"); char[] c = df.format(d).toCharArray() ; StringBuffer buf = new StringBuffer(); String reStr = null; int cLength = c.length; for(int i=0;i<c.length;i++){ String s = ""+c; if(s.equals(".")){ cLength++; continue; } int cp = Integer.parseInt(s); buf.append(capi[ cp ]); buf.append(digit[cLength-i-1]); } reStr = buf.toString(); System.out.println(":::::"+reStr); for(int j=0;j<2;j++){ reStr = reStr.replaceAll( "零零", "零");//replaceAll:jdk1.4才有 reStr = reStr.replaceAll( "零亿", "亿"); reStr = reStr.replaceAll( "零万", "万"); reStr = reStr.replaceAll( "零仟", "零"); reStr = reStr.replaceAll( "零佰", "零"); reStr = reStr.replaceAll( "零拾", "零"); reStr = reStr.replaceAll( "零角", "零"); reStr = reStr.replaceAll( "亿万", "亿零"); reStr = reStr.replaceAll( "零分", "元整"); reStr = reStr.replaceAll( "零元", "元"); reStr = reStr.replaceAll( "零零", "零"); reStr = reStr.replaceAll( "角元整", "角整"); reStr = reStr.replaceAll( "元元", "元"); } return reStr; } //吴兵写的 /** * 将数据转换为金额大写 * @param amount - 待转换的字符串 * @return 被转换后的金额大写。 */ public static String money2RMB(double amount) { String returnStr = ""; String[] strFigure = { "零", "壹", "贰", "叁", "肆", "伍", "陆", "柒", "捌", "玖"}; double oldAmount = amount; String[] strUnit = { "无", "分", "角", "元", "拾", "佰", "仟", "万", "拾", "佰", "仟", "亿", "拾", "佰", "仟"}; double tempAmount = amount; amount = Math.abs(amount); if (tempAmount != amount) { returnStr = "负"; } DecimalFormat df = new DecimalFormat("###0.00"); String strAmount = df.format(amount); strAmount = replace(strAmount, ".", ""); int strLength = strAmount.length(); String myNum = ""; for (int i = 1; i <= strLength; i++) { myNum = strAmount.substring(i - 1, i); int len = strLength + 1 - i; returnStr += strFigure[Integer.parseInt(myNum)] + strUnit[len]; } //System.out.println(returnStr); for (int i = 1; i < strUnit.length; i++) { String tempStr = ""; if (! (strUnit.equals("万") || strUnit.equals("亿"))) { tempStr = "零" + strUnit + "零"; returnStr = replace(returnStr, tempStr, "零"); } } returnStr = replace(returnStr, "零亿", "亿"); returnStr = replace(returnStr, "零万", "万"); returnStr = replace(returnStr, "零仟", "零"); returnStr = replace(returnStr, "零佰", "零"); returnStr = replace(returnStr, "零拾", "零"); returnStr = replace(returnStr, "零角", "零"); returnStr = replace(returnStr, "亿万", "亿零"); if (returnStr.endsWith("零分")) { returnStr = replace(returnStr, "零分", "元整"); } returnStr = replace(returnStr, "元元", "元"); return returnStr; } /** * 将line中所有的oldString用newString替换. * * @param line 提供将要替换的字符串 * @param oldString 被替换掉的字符串 * @param newString 替换成的字符串 * * @return 所有的oldString用newString替换的line */ public static final String replace(String line, String oldString, String newString) { if (line == null) { return null; } int i = 0; if ( (i = line.indexOf(oldString, i)) >= 0) { char[] line2 = line.toCharArray(); char[] newString2 = newString.toCharArray(); int oLength = oldString.length(); StringBuffer buf = new StringBuffer(line2.length); buf.append(line2, 0, i).append(newString2); i += oLength; int j = i; while ( (i = line.indexOf(oldString, i)) > 0) { buf.append(line2, j, i - j).append(newString2); i += oLength; j = i; } buf.append(line2, j, line2.length - j); return buf.toString(); } return line; } public static void main(String[] args){ System.out.println(money2RMB(70000050002.100)); System.out.println(moneyToRMB(70000050002.100)); } }; 本文出自 51CTO.COM技术博客 |
